Dateiupload und Java
Anton Peissinger
- java
Hallo!
Ich hab folgendes kleine Problemchen...
Gibt es eine Möglichkeit, eine Datei, die
in einem HTML-Dokument
duch ein Formular mit dem Tag
<input type="file" method="post"...>
zum Webserver upgeloaded wird,
mittels Java (evtl. Servlet-Erweiterung für Webserver)
auszuwerten oder einzulesen?
Ich will aber kein CGI-verwenden.
Vielleicht etwas zum Hintergrund...
Ich will es dem Anwender ermöglichen,
XML-Dateinen upzuloaden, die dann automatisch
in eine Datenbank übernommen werden.
Da die XML-Verarbeitung bereits mit Java
geschieht, wäre es sehr vorteilhaft,
wenn ich bei dieser Sprache bleiben
könnte und nicht zusätzlich auch CGI-Skripten
einsetzen müsste.
Falls jemand eine Idee hat, wie sich
das realisieren lässt, immer her damit.
Vielan Dank für die Mühe im Voraus
Gruss
Anton Peissinger
Hallo Anton,
spontan fallen mir da Cookies ein <../../tecbb.htm#a5>,
mit dieser Technik kann man relativ einfach etwas auf die Festplatte des Users schreiben.
Allerdings weiß ich nicht, ob die Möglichkeiten die man mit Cookies hat für deine Ansprüche
ausreichen.
Aber die Leute hier im Forum sind immer sehr creativ, da bekommst Du bestimmt
noch viele Anregungen.
Viele Grüße
surfhead
Hallo Anton,
spontan fallen mir da Cookies ein
Gemeint war glaub ich die andere Richtung, Upload einer
Datei die auf der Festplatte des Clients ist, hoch zum Server.
Und ganz ohne CGI gehts nicht, aber Du kannst ja mal versuchen,
ein "fertiges" Perl-Upload-Script auf dem Server zu installieren.
Oder selbst schreiben. Ein "Kochrezept" findest Du hier im
Forum unter http://www.teamone.de/selfaktuell/artikel/aspupload.htm ,
ist zwar nicht in Perl, aber die Struktur des Upload-Streams geht ganz gut daraus hervor.
MfG Christoph